This is my first post so please excuse me if I break any protocol rules. I have just bought a used Superb Elegance 2.5TDi after 6 years driving an E class Merc and am very pleased with it so far. However I have one problem.

The previous owner had fitted a Blaupunkt E1 travelpilot radio/sat nav system, but not by his Skoda dealer. The result is that the steering wheel controls, the instrument display and the boot CD changer all do not work. I think that Skoda used to sell this as a dealer fit option for the Superb.

Has anyone come across this problem and been able to sort it out please?

I have been told that the wriring may by CAN-BUS multiplex (whatever that means) which is supposed to make it much more difficult to get adaptors etc. Is that correct?

Thanks for your help

The blaupunkt cannot control the factory cd changer or dash display/steering controls. I think the E1 needed a special CD changer although I am not sure. If you want a changer have a look at www.bluespot.co.uk as they should be a able to supply one, you will need to run a new cable to the changer and connect a power cable behind the hu.

The only HU that works with the steering controls/dash display and the oem changer will be the one that was fitted when the car was new.

I have also been told on numerous times that only the original head unit will work with the sterring wheel controls and dot-matrix display in the dash...if there were one that did, I would have it in mine.

I am afraid the replies are correct signals are sent via one of the cars CAN buses and its not possible to interface with this, only the OEM sat nav is capable of interfacing with the multidot display and multifunction controls.
